What would you all do if your photographer LOST all of your wedding photos?

It didn't happen to us, but did to our good friend that we were in the wedding. They chose a $1200 package from a reputable photographer in our area. They ended up spending close to $4000 with her (I have no idea how) and when they scheduled an appt to view and order she told them that she couldn't find their pics. Supposedly if she hasn't found them by today she is refunding there money. But what would you do if you were in her (the bride's) shoes?

    I will impose bodily harm probably. My bridesmaid was a second shooter at a wedding where the main shooter admitted to her that he lost a prior couple's wedding photos. She told him that even if he accidently deletes the photos, most software systems have a backup file. He was able to take his computer to a local computer shop, where the photos were found.

    I would have your friend try that. The photos are mostly likely misplaced, not deleted. If they are somehow deleted, call Judge Judy.
